Twice Grammy awarded and 12 times nominated Los Angeles top songwriter, recording artist, guitarist, producer, arranger, engineer, and more - Jay Graydon alias RAKE himself, is now making the Japanese version (18 tracks) of his surf album available to the rest of the world!

This is an album which will take you back to the sixties when the surf music waves were high. It is recorded in a surf style (Dick Dale, Ventures type of thing) with a host of the best studio musicians in the world, such as Dean Parks (Steely Dan), Steve Lukather (Toto), David Hungate (Toto), John Ferraro, Joseph Williams (Toto), Jason Scheff (Chicago) and many more.
